Activate the Faucets


When the temperature decreases as well as it seems as if the freezing temperature will last, it will help to turn on your water both indoors and outdoors. This will maintain the water moving via your plumbing systems. On top of that, the movement will certainly decrease the cold procedure. Especially, there's no need to transform it on full blast. You'll wind up wasting gallons of water by doing this. Rather, aim for about 5 drops per minute.

When Pipes are Frozen, shut Off Water


If you discover that your pipes are totally icy or almost nearing that stage, turn off the main water valve right away. You will normally discover this in your basement or utility room near the heater or the front wall closest to the street. Turn it off as soon as possible to avoid additional damage.
Don't fail to remember to shut outside water sources, as well, such as your connection for the garden home. Doing this will avoid extra water from filling your plumbing system. With more water, more ice will stack up, which will at some point lead to break pipelines. Winter is coming


Homeowners that go through extreme winters with low temperatures can often face frozen pipes, cracking and other plumbing problems that appear during winter. Here are some basic tips on what to do in such a situation.


Prevent freezing of your pipes on time


Freezing of outside pipes can affect interior plumbing as well. Before the real low temperatures arrive, ensure all measures of caution. We recommend you to eliminate outside hosepipes and insulate exterior fixtures with special caps. If you worry about standing water, you can easily clean it using compressed air.


What if your hosepipe is already frozen?


The smartest thing to do is not to panic and take action. First, make sure you turn the water supply off. Then, get the hose off the spigot and check the spigot. If ice formed un spigot, then heat it up until it thaws. Also, heat the place where the spigot is connected to your home. This will ensure that the entire pipe is free of ice blockages.
